Hi All,

Before I go to the lawyers, just wondering if anyone has any idea what the process is.

basically my company is readjusting the job families - I am currently a "programer analyst", they are switching that to "Software engineer".

Will anything need done? My petition that I am now happily working on is under "programer analyst". My job role is not changing, just my job family.

Anyone have any ideas?

Dont sweat it.
I came to the US on one job title and subsequently changed twice either by promotion or by change of department. I had 2 renewals of my L1 each time with different job titles and neither were rejected. The lawyers and HR people who put the case to the Immigration Service seem to know how to get them passed.
It is to be expected that employees 'grow' within their companies as well as job titles change when departments re-organise themselves as they do from time to time.

Yeah, there's some latitude; I was formerly an "Application Support Specialist" and am now a "Business Analyst III", but it's because of a general standardization of titles within my department and none of the folks who had work visas are having any problems. It's not a signficant change.

thanks all

I spoke with the company immigration lawyer, she said that as long as the job description didn't change, no action was required.

If i change positions, all that will be required is an adjustment and it is pretty straight forward.
